It is the want of understanding of the value of this earth on the part of the farmer that tempts the village manufacturer to rob his stalls, and walls of such an important manure and prepare the salt for a foreign market. For, India exports as much as 20,000 tons of refined nitre to foreign countries. Imagine the consequences of this incredible thoughtlessness! The writer strongly feels that any effort which aims at inducing the ryot to make a systematic use of his "salt earth," directly contributes to his prosperity.
